Tokyo: The Electric Heartbeat

No trip to Japan is complete without spending ample time in Tokyo, a city where ancient traditions seamlessly blend with futuristic innovation. My vlog will showcase the vibrant energy of:
Shibuya Crossing: The world's busiest intersection is a spectacle in itself. Capture the organized chaos as thousands of people cross simultaneously – a truly unique visual experience. Don't forget the iconic Hachiko statue nearby!
Senso-ji Temple: Immerse yourselves in the serene atmosphere of Tokyo's oldest temple. Wander through Nakamise-dori, the bustling market leading to the temple, and witness traditional crafts and delicious street food. The temple itself is breathtaking, a tranquil oasis amidst the city's hustle.
Harajuku: Unleash your inner fashionista in Harajuku, the epicenter of youth culture and street style. Explore Takeshita Street, a vibrant pedestrian paradise filled with quirky shops, colorful crepes, and unique fashion boutiques. It's a visual feast for the eyes!
TeamLab Borderless: Step into a digital art wonderland at TeamLab Borderless. This interactive museum is a feast for the senses, with stunning light installations and immersive experiences that will leave you mesmerized. It’s a must-have shot for your vlog.
Shinjuku Gyoen National Garden: Escape the city's clamor in this tranquil oasis. The garden boasts a stunning blend of Japanese, English, and French landscape styles, offering a peaceful retreat where you can enjoy the serenity of nature.

Kyoto: Ancient Capitals and Tranquil Temples

Journey back in time in Kyoto, Japan's former imperial capital. This city is a treasure trove of ancient temples, serene gardens, and traditional geisha districts. My vlog will feature:
Fushimi Inari Shrine: Hike through the thousands of vibrant red torii gates that wind their way up the mountainside. This iconic landmark is both visually stunning and spiritually significant. It's a great spot for capturing breathtaking panoramic views and atmospheric shots.
Kiyomizu-dera Temple: Marvel at the stunning wooden stage of Kiyomizu-dera Temple, offering panoramic views of Kyoto. The temple's history and architecture are captivating, and the surrounding area is equally charming.
Arashiyama Bamboo Grove: Lose yourselves in the ethereal beauty of the Arashiyama Bamboo Grove. The towering bamboo stalks create a magical atmosphere, perfect for peaceful contemplation and stunning photography.
Kinkaku-ji (Golden Pavilion): Witness the shimmering gold of Kinkaku-ji, a Zen Buddhist temple covered in gold leaf. Its reflection in the pond is simply magical, creating a truly unforgettable image for your vlog.
Gion District: Explore Gion, Kyoto's geisha district, and perhaps catch a glimpse of a geiko or maiko (apprentice geisha) gracefully making their way through the traditional streets. It's a glimpse into a bygone era.

Beyond the Cities: Natural Wonders and Hidden Charms

Japan offers much more than bustling cities. Venture beyond the urban landscapes to discover:
Mount Fuji: Witness the majestic beauty of Mount Fuji, Japan's iconic symbol. Capture its breathtaking silhouette, particularly stunning at sunrise or sunset. Consider a hike (depending on the season and your fitness level) for an even more memorable experience.
Hiroshima Peace Memorial Park: Reflect on history at the Hiroshima Peace Memorial Park, a poignant reminder of the atomic bombing and a testament to peace and remembrance. This is a powerful and moving experience.
Osaka Castle: Explore Osaka Castle, a majestic landmark with a rich history. The castle's imposing structure and surrounding park offer stunning photo opportunities.
Nara Park: Interact with friendly wild deer roaming freely in Nara Park. It's a unique and charming experience, offering a different perspective on Japan's natural and cultural landscape.
Hakone: Experience the beauty of Hakone, a mountain resort town known for its hot springs, stunning views of Mount Fuji, and art museums. A relaxing onsen experience is a must!


Tips for your Japan Vlog:

To create a truly captivating Japan vlog, remember to:
Plan your itinerary: Japan is vast, so prioritize your must-see destinations.
Utilize Japan Rail Pass: This cost-effective pass makes traveling between cities easy and efficient.
Learn basic Japanese phrases: Even a few words will enhance your interactions with locals.
Embrace the culture: Respect local customs and traditions.
Capture the details: Pay attention to the small things that make Japan unique, from charming street scenes to intricate details in temples.
Edit your footage creatively: Use music, transitions, and text overlays to create a dynamic and engaging vlog.
